Minecraft Bedrock Chat Event

OS Name/Version: Ubuntu Server 20.04

Product Name/Version: AMP Release “Triton” v2.3.2.12, built 05/05/2022 18:13

Problem Description:

When I create an event within the Schedule of a Minecraft Bedrock instance for “A player sends a chat message”, it does not fire. Additionally, the log for the instance when set to debug level does not show any attempts to fire this event but runs others including “A player leaves the server” as expected.

Steps to reproduce:

  • Step 1: navigate to a Minecraft Bedrock instance
  • Step 2: go to Schedule
  • Step 3: add a new trigger for “A player sends a chat message”
  • Step 4: add a new task within this trigger for anything
  • Step 5: connect to the Minecraft Bedrock instance and send a message and observe the event not being triggered

Actions taken to resolve so far:

  • Applied all available updates for both AMP and Minecraft Bedrock
  • Checked JSON parsing of the schedule JSON files
  • Sent messages as the server as opposed to a player
  • Changed the type of event that is called by the trigger to ensure that it isn’t specific to the event I’d like to use (sending a Discord message)
  • Full reboot of the Ubuntu system and multiple reboots of the instance
  • Deletion and re-creation of the events and the triggers

The Bedrock server does not log chat events to its console, this isn’t an AMP issue - it’s been an ongoing annoyance in the Minecraft community for some time.
